Instructions
. Make the Cake
1.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our two 9-inch round cake pans or line them with parchment paper.
2. Mix Dry Ingredients: In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. Set aside.
3. Cream Butter and Sugar: In a large mixing bowl, beat the softened but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ar together until light and fluffy, about 3-4 minutes.
4. Add Eggs and Vanilla: Beat in the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Stir in the vanilla extract.
5. Add Butterscotch Chips: Stir in the melted butterscotch chips until well incorporated.
Alternate Wet and Dry Ingredients: Gradually add the flour mixture to the wet ingredients, alternating with the buttermilk. Begin and end with the flour mixture, mixing until just combined.
6. Bake: Divide the batter evenly between the prepared cake pans.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center of the cakes comes out clean.
7. Cool: Allow the cakes to cool in the pans for 10 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.
. Make the Frosting
1. Cream the Butter: In a large mixing bowl, beat the softened butter until creamy.
2. Add Powdered Sugar: Gradually add the powdered sugar, 1 cup at a time, mixing well after each addition.
3. Add Cream and Butterscotch Sauce: Beat in the heavy cream, butterscotch sauce, and vanilla extract until smooth and fluffy. If the frosting is too thick, add more cream, 1 tablespoon at a time, until the desired consistency is reached.
. Assemble the Cake
1. Frost the Cake: Place one cake layer on a serving plate. Spread a layer of frosting over the top, then place the second cake layer on top. Frost the top and sides of the cake.
2. Add Toffee Bits: Sprinkle the toffee bits over the top of the cake, pressing some into the sides if desired.
Tips for Perfect Toffee Butterscotch Cake
Use Room Temperature Ingredients: Make sure the butter, eggs, and buttermilk are at room temperature for easier mixing and a smoother batter.
Don’t Overmix: Mix the batter until just combined to keep the cake tender.
Cool Completely Before Frosting: Make sure the cakes are completely cool before frosting to prevent the frosting from melting.
Recipe Variations
Butterscotch Pecan Cake: Add 1 cup of chopped pecans to the cake batter for added crunch and flavor.
Salted Caramel Drizzle: Drizzle salted caramel sauce over the top of the frosted cake for an extra layer of sweetness.
Butterscotch Cupcakes: Use the batter to make cupcakes instead. Bake for 18-20 minutes, then frost as directed.
FAQS
Q: Can I use store-bought butterscotch sauce?
A: Yes, store-bought butterscotch sauce works perfectly for this recipe. You can also make your own if you prefer.
Q: How do I store leftover cake?
A: Store leftover cake in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days or in the refrigerator for up to 5 days.
Q: Can I freeze this cake?
A: Yes, you can freeze the cake layers before frosting. Wrap them tightly in plastic wrap and aluminum foil, and freeze for up to 3 months. Thaw overnight in the refrigerator before frosting and serving.
